Yuko Oshima, 23, of Japan's girl pop group AKB48, appears on a screen after being crowned its favourite member at an annual popularity "election" event at Tokyo's Budokan gymnasium June 6, 2012. In a three-hour show broadcast live from Tokyo's hallowed Budokan, Oshima was selected as leader and face of the group, which has been recognized by Guinness as the world's biggest girl pop group. AKB48 is known for its perky routines and high "kawaii," or cuteness, quotient. Every year, fans vote to determine 64 of the most popular girls out of a 237-member pool who are then rotated in and out of four main troupes and several affiliated groups according to their popularity.
